SUMMARY

The Salesforce Business Analyst acts as facilitator and mediator for Salesforce Sales and CPQ/Revenue Cloud capabilities. You will be responsible for supporting the implementation of a new Salesforce CPQ and redesign of existing Sales Cloud capabilities. Using your knowledge of Salesforce Sales Cloud, CPQ/Revenue Cloud, and its integrated systems, you will work with cross functional teams to improve processes, document business requirements and guide functionality with a focus on simplicity and scale.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of customer operations and processes; experience documenting process flows, provide testing and training support which will enable our entire sales motion from opportunities to post-sales support.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Lead requirements gathering sessions and interview cross functional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) to capture business requirements
  • Analyze existing and future state business processes, systems and flows of data to identify and drive optimization opportunities for Salesforce Sales Cloud and CPQ/Revenue Cloud
  • Design potential solutions to any problems identified in support of Salesforce Sales Cloud and CPQ/Revenue Cloud
  • Prepare and deliver a report of findings to leadership with comprehensive risk and impact assessment.
  • Develop comprehensive end-to-end (E2E) test cases at the Salesforce Sales Cloud, CPQ and platform level.
  • Provide functional leadership and best practice insights.
  • Work with business stakeholders to understand processes, prioritize needs, and translate requirements into system solutions.
  • Document business processes, requirements, and solution designs in Azure DevOps (ADO), modifying User Stories and Tasks.
  • Carry out periodic quality checks.
  • Work collaboratively with administrators and developers to design, test, and implement solutions.
  • Assist with project management.
  • Assist in UAT and Change Control tasks and record keeping.
  • Work with training team and change management resources to support training needs.
  • Keep current on available releases, technologies, and applications. Provide guidance to application architects and process owners as needed.
